COMPARISON BETWEEN KETOPROFEN AND KETOPROFEN WITH DOXYCYCLINE GEL AS LOCAL DRUG DELIVERY IN SMOKERS AND NON SMOKERS CHRONIC PERIODONTITIS PATIENTS.

Phase 2
Completed
Conditions
Health Condition 1: K053- Chronic periodontitisHealth Condition 2: F172- Nicotine dependence
Registration Number
CTRI/2020/03/024280
Lead Sponsor
MANUBHAI PATEL DENTAL COLLEGE AND ORALRESEARCH INSTITUTE

Inclusion Criteria

(1) at least 20 natural teeth present

(2) probing depth of at least 4mm and clinical attachment loss of at least 2mm in all quadrants of the mouth.

(3) smokers group having subjects smoking at least 10 cigarettes/bidis per day

(4) non smokers group having subjects who have never smoked cigarettes or any other form of tobacco.

(5) willingness to comply with the study protocol.

Exclusion Criteria

(1) existing systemic disease that may affect the severity or progression of periodontal disease.

(2) medication consumption that may influence the periodontium (e.g. non ste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s or antibiotics) within 6 months preceding the beginning of intervention.

(3)subjects undergoing orthodontic treatment or extensive restorations

(4) patients with aggressive periodontitis or multiple caries

(5) patients during pregnancy or lactation

(6) patients allergic to doxycycline or ketoprofen
